Understanding Solar Cookers
Solar cookers are devices that use sunlight as the primary energy source to prepare food. They function on the principle of converting solar radiation into heat, which is then utilized for cooking.
Types of Solar Cookers
There are several types of solar cookers available, each with its unique features:
- Box Cookers: These are insulated boxes with a transparent lid that trap heat inside. They are perfect for slow cooking and can retain heat remarkably well.
- Parabolic Cookers: These use a curved reflective surface to concentrate sunlight onto a single point, achieving higher temperatures suitable for frying and baking.

Materials Needed for Your Solar Cooker Project
Before we get into the construction phase, it’s essential to gather the necessary materials. For a simple box cooker, you will need:
| Materials | Approximate Quantity |
|---|---|
| Cardboard Box | 1 (Large) |
| Aluminum Foil | 1 Roll |
| Clear Plastic Wrap | 2 pieces (thick) |
| Black Paint | 1 Can (for interior) |
| Insulation Material | Varies (e.g., Styrofoam) |
| Wooden Stick or Rod | 1 (for adjusting angle) |
| Cooking Pot | 1 (preferably black) |
Step-by-Step Instructions for Building Your Solar Cooker
Now that you have gathered all the materials, let’s move onto the construction of your solar cooker. We will follow a step-by-step approach to make the process as smooth as possible.
Step 1: Prepare the Box
Begin with a large cardboard box—this will act as the main body of your solar cooker. Ensure the box is clean and in good condition.
Insulate the Box
To help retain heat, it’s essential to insulate the internals of your box. You can use Styrofoam, old newspapers, or any other insulating material. Lay the insulation on the bottom and sides of the box.
Step 2: Paint the Interior
Next, paint the interior of the box with black paint. The black color is crucial as it absorbs heat more effectively than any other color. Allow the paint to dry thoroughly before proceeding to the next step.
Step 3: Create the Reflective Surface
Cut sections of aluminum foil and carefully attach them to the inner flap of the box’s lid. The shiny surface will act as a reflector that directs sunlight into the cooker.
Make sure to keep the foil smooth to maximize reflectivity.
Step 4: Add the Transparent Cover
Using clear plastic wrap, cover the opening of the box to create a greenhouse effect. Stretch the plastic wrap tightly to minimize gaps and secure it with tape.
This will trap heat inside and maintain a high cooking temperature.
Step 5: Set Up a Positioning Mechanism
To optimize your solar cooker’s efficiency, it’s essential to adjust its angle according to the sun’s position. Use a wooden stick or rod to support the lid at different angles. This adjustment will help capture maximum sunlight throughout the day.
Step 6: Cooking with Your Solar Cooker
Once your solar cooker is built, it’s time to test it! Place a cooking pot, preferably black, inside the box. It’s advisable to use glass or metal pots as they conduct heat effectively.

Important Tips for Effective Solar Cooking
To make the most out of your solar cooker:
Check the Weather
Sunny days are ideal for solar cooking. Try to avoid days with heavy cloud cover, rain, or extreme weather conditions.
Angle Your Cooker Properly
Always position your solar cooker to face the sun directly. As the sun moves, be ready to adjust the cooker’s angle to ensure it continues to capture sunlight effectively.
Keep the Lid Closed
Whenever possible, keep the lid closed during the cooking process. This helps retain heat and moisture, promoting even cooking.

How long does it take to cook food in a solar cooker?
The cooking time in a solar cooker varies based on numerous factors including the cooker’s design, the intensity of sunlight, and the type of food being prepared. In general, cooking times can be longer than conventional methods, often ranging from one to several hours. For instance, items like rice or casseroles may take about 1 to 3 hours, while baked goods can take even longer.
It’s essential to monitor the cooking progress and adjust the cooker’s position to maximize sun exposure throughout the cooking period. Experimenting with your solar cooker will help you better understand its specific cooking capabilities and how different dishes respond to solar heat.
Do solar cookers work on cloudy days?
Solar cookers can still function on cloudy days, but their efficiency is significantly reduced. While direct sunlight provides the most effective heating, diffused sunlight can still allow for some cooking to occur. It may take longer to achieve the desired cooking results, and the temperature inside the cooker will generally be lower than on sunny days.
To improve results on cloudy days, you can try to position your solar cooker in a location that receives the maximum amount of indirect sunlight. Additionally, using dark, heat-absorbing cookware can help enhance cooking performance even when the sun isn’t shining brightly.
